Overview
The Jianhu JH Series Walk-in Environmental Test Chamber is an engineered solution for precise, repeatable, and scalable environmental simulation in research laboratories, academic institutions, and industrial R&D facilities. Designed around a robust dual-refrigeration and electric heating architecture with cascade refrigeration for sub-zero operation, the chamber employs a closed-loop PID control system coupled with high-density insulation (≥150 mm polyurethane foam), double-glazed observation windows, and airtight gasketed access doors. Its core function is to replicate dynamic thermal–hygric stress profiles—specifically rapid temperature transitions under controlled relative humidity conditions—enabling accelerated life testing, material stability assessment, and process validation per international standards including IEC 60068-2, MIL-STD-810H, and ISO 16750-4. Unlike benchtop chambers, the walk-in configuration supports full-scale equipment under test (EUT), multi-sample arrays, and operator-in-the-loop experimental protocols—critical for aerospace component qualification, battery thermal runaway studies, and pharmaceutical stability trials.
Key Features
- Rapid thermal ramping capability: Achieves up to 3 °C/min heating rate across the full −50 °C to +150 °C operating range, enabled by variable-frequency drive (VFD)-controlled compressors and modulating electric heaters.
- Low-noise operational design: Acoustic enclosure, vibration-damped mounting, and optimized airflow distribution reduce ambient noise to ≤62 dB(A) at 1 m—compliant with ISO 7779 and suitable for shared laboratory spaces.
- Intuitive human-machine interface (HMI): 10.1″ color touchscreen with multilingual support (English, German, Japanese), real-time trend plotting, and programmable multi-step profiles (up to 99 segments, 999 cycles).
- Structural integrity and safety: Reinforced stainless-steel interior (SUS304), external structural frame (powder-coated carbon steel), integrated over-temperature and over-humidity cut-off, and emergency stop with mechanical latch.
- Energy-efficient architecture: VFD-based compressor modulation eliminates on/off cycling losses; intelligent defrost logic minimizes downtime; optional heat recovery module available for facility integration.
Sample Compatibility & Compliance
The JH chamber accommodates heterogeneous sample types—including electronic enclosures, automotive ECUs, medical device packaging, polymer composites, and biological specimen racks—without compromising thermal uniformity or humidity stability. Internal volume scalability (standard configurations from 1.5 m³ to 25 m³, fully customizable) allows integration of auxiliary instrumentation (e.g., data loggers, thermocouple trees, IR cameras) via pre-routed conduit ports. All units are manufactured in accordance with ISO 9001:2015 quality management systems and undergo factory acceptance testing (FAT) per ASTM E145-22 (Standard Specification for Gravity-Convection and Forced-Ventilation Ovens). Humidity control (10–98% RH, ±3% RH accuracy) utilizes steam injection with deionized water feed, meeting USP requirements for pharmaceutical environmental qualification. Documentation packages include IQ/OQ templates aligned with FDA 21 CFR Part 11 and EU Annex 11 expectations.
Software & Data Management
Jianhu’s proprietary WinTest Pro software enables remote monitoring, profile scheduling, alarm logging, and automated report generation (PDF/CSV). The system supports OPC UA connectivity for integration into LabVantage, Siemens Desigo, or custom MES platforms. Audit trails record all user actions—including parameter changes, door openings, and calibration events—with time-stamped digital signatures. Data integrity safeguards include encrypted local storage (SSD-backed), redundant SD card backup, and optional cloud synchronization with TLS 1.3 encryption. Software validation documentation (SVR) and electronic signature compliance (21 CFR Part 11 Annex A) are available upon request for GxP-regulated environments.
Applications
- Academic research: Thermal aging of nanocomposites, glass transition mapping of biopolymers, freeze-thaw cycling of cryopreserved cell lines.
- Electronics reliability: JEDEC JESD22-A104 thermal cycling, IPC-9701 solder joint fatigue simulation, EV battery pack thermal propagation testing.
- Pharmaceutical development: ICH Q1A(R3) long-term/accelerated stability studies, container-closure integrity validation under cyclic humidity stress.
- Aerospace qualification: RTCA DO-160 Section 4 temperature shock, MIL-STD-810H Method 501.7 low-temperature operation, and Method 502.7 high-temperature storage.
- Automotive component validation: ISO 16750-4 powertrain ECU thermal soak, GB/T 28046-2011 vehicle electronics environmental endurance.
